This Key Fob Shell Case Replacement is a durable, precision-engineered cover designed exclusively for 5-button Ford and Lincoln keyless remotes from 2013 to 2020. Made from a sturdy metal and plastic blend, it allows easy DIY installation without reprogramming, restoring your worn or broken key fob to like-new condition while maintaining perfect fit and function.

The original Lincoln fobs are cheap plastic that break easily if u drop them, which I do a lot. These may not be any better quality but they seem to be exactly the same as OEM. Just pop out the green computer board, emergency key, and CR2032 batts (two, with + sides of both touching) and reassemble in the new pieces. There’s no instructions, so if this stuff doesn’t come easily to you, take pics of the original key fob as you disassemble it. And don’t forget there are TWO sides of the fob that need to be popped off and reassembled. The first has the green board, nestled in the translucent rubber protector, and batteries. Use a knife to pop that side off. The second opens with the little latch, enclosed is your emergency key. Make sure not to throw that away! Once all is reassembled, press hard to snap together. Its a pain in the butt to snap together especially if you use a combination of 2025 and 2032 batteries for a little bit more battery life. 2 2025 batteries should snap together a little easier. Once you take your old fob apart, put the old metal key into the back slot of the new battery compartment piece. Then put your new silicone button cover over the old mother board and set it into the half of the fob that has the buttons. Next, make sure the silver metal key ring attachment is attached to the outer back part of the fob. Next snap the battery piece into the outer back part of the fob starting at the side with the key ring and as you close it, use your finger nail to pull down the little spring button on the back side. It should snap together. Put your batteries in flat smooth side with the + together. Lastly, snap the 2 main pieces together starting at the side opposite the key ring and try to avoid touching the car alarm button unless you dont really care what your neighbors think. This part is difficult because the amount of force required for this last snap might require a pair of pliers and wrap the plastic with a tissue to avoid scratching the fob. Do everything slow and watch as the pieces come together to make sure they're going in right. Remeber, its plastic. It wants to break so you have to buy a new one.
